2016 Drew Pinot Noir "Wendling Vineyard"

Drew 2016 Wendling Vineyard Pinot Noir

Winery: Drew

Vintage: 2016

Wine Name/Vineyard: "Wendling Vineyard"

Wine Category: Pinot Noir

Grape blend: 100% Pinot Noir

Bottle size: 750 ml

Region: Anderson Valley

State or country: CA

Price: $48

Cases produced: unknown

KWG Score: 91.6 (based on 3 reviews)

Ken's Wine Rating: Very Good+ (91)

Review date: August 5, 2018

Wine Review: This dark red colored Pinot Noir opens with a fragrant strawberry rhubarb bouquet with a hint of sandalwood and black cherry. On the palate, this wine is medium bodied, balanced, juicy and fruit forward. The flavor profile is strawberry rhubarb and oak blend with hints of craisin, plum and earth minerality. The finish is dry and its mild fine tannins linger nicely. This Pinot Noir would pair nicely with The Lady and Son's smoked Boston butt pork roast. Enjoy - Ken
